Grasping Satellite Tracker Functionality

Learning how a satellite system actually operates is essential for maximizing its benefits. At its core, a device depends on a network of space-based satellites to pinpoint its exact position. It receives signals from several satellites, utilizing a positioning process to find its present latitude and easting. This data is then relayed – via mobile networks, satellite communication, or both – to a central interface where it can be tracked. The frequency of these transmissions is configured by the subscriber, balancing the requirement for real-time reporting with battery life.

Security Risks with Track Manager Monitoring Platforms

The proliferation of campaign manager monitoring platforms introduces a complex web of safety challenges. These platforms, often handling sensitive user data and valuable marketing information, become attractive areas for malicious actors. Hacked accounts can lead to unauthorized data access, fraudulent advertising spend, and reputational damage. Furthermore, integration with third-party providers presents its own set of dangers, as vulnerabilities in those connections can create entry points for attackers. Proper security measures, including robust authentication, regular audits, and strict access controls, are essential to mitigate these potential risks and protect critical data. Ignoring these factors leaves organizations exposed to significant financial and reputational loss. Regular vigilance and proactive vulnerability practices are therefore absolutely crucial.
